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ions Ruby versions prior to 2.4.8 Ruby versions 2.5.x through 2.5.6 Ruby versions 2.6.x through 2.6.4
Description The issue arises from the mishandling of path checking within the File.fnmatch functions in Ruby. This could potentially allow a remote attacker to gain unauthorized access to protected information by exploiting the vulnerability with a specially crafted script.
Recommendations For Ruby versions prior to 2.4.8, update to version 2.4.8 or later. For Ruby versions 2.5.x through 2.5.6, update to version 2.5.7 or later. For Ruby versions 2.6.x through 2.6.4, update to version 2.6.5 or later.
